Splet07. apr. 2024 · slide 6 of 86. Nevus sebaceus from scalp showing papillomatosis, hyperkeratosis and sebaceous hyperplasia. Note the absence of hair follicles. Sebaceous glands are abnormal in their morphology and distribution in a nevus sebaceus. They are often present high within the dermis and sometimes communicate directly with the …
